Producer notes: "100% Pinot Noir from Silver Pines Vineyard, Bennett Valley, Sonoma County. Clones: 80% Mariafeld, 20% Pommard. Raised for 10 months in 100% French oak (80% new). The Vagrant is the only Pinot Noir that will bear the Argot name from the 2010 vintage. The production level is tragically low. What arrives in the glass is a stunning Pinot Noir that will caress every nook and cranny of your sensorial experience. Each bottle we have opened has offered immediate gratification. We believe The Vagrant will reward short term cellaring. We adore this juice." Argot winemaker Justin Harmon crafts small lots of white and red wines including Pinot Noir at Vinify in Santa Rosa.
